25% Revenue Growth Powers Record 2Q25 Results
July 18, 2025 7:30 AM EDTSecond Quarter Core Net New Assets Equal $80.3 Billion, Up 31% Year-Over-Year
New Accounts Exceed 1 Million and Total Client Assets Reach a Record $10.76 Trillion
Record Quarterly GAAP Earnings Per Share of $1.08, $1.14 Adjusted (1)
WESTLAKE, Texas--(BUSINESS WIRE)-- The Charles Schwab Corporation reported net income for the second quarter totaling $2.1 billion, or $1.08 earnings per share. Excluding $128 million of pre-tax transaction-related costs, adjusted (1) net income and earnings per share equaled $2.2 billion and $1.14, respectively.
